Call it what you like, The Great Resignation, The Great Reshuffle, or even The Great Reimagination, the employment landscape in Australia has changed radically in the past two years. CEO of the Australian HR Institute Sarah McCann Bartlett and career coach Kate Richardson talk us through how can you use this moment in time to your career advantage and what businesses need to do to get through it.We also hear stories of pandemic career changes from software engineer Zubin, UX designer Fern and clinical researcher Fay.Producer: Maria Tickle
